Transaction 3f6a3109919e51f687c5c4e5714582f04ad69420c3147f63cfadbad837f49ba0
1 Input
1 Output
-
3f6a3109919e51f687c5c4e5714582f04ad69420c3147f63cfadbad837f49ba0:0
- value
- 490084
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62ce3f1a14f44d6aae023db1bc11917231799f5d OP_EQUAL
- address
- 3AhTDbnhBa6Fhan2qUZKaxWRrFzrzyWbHD